Bitcoin's Current Stance Critical as RSI Indicates Overextended Market Positions
In a recent development, Bloomberg analyst Mike McGlone has issued a warning that a sudden price surge in Bitcoin could potentially prompt a reaction from the U.S. Federal Reserve. This cautionary statement comes as bullish indicators are appearing alongside wider global news about cryptocurrency.
The market remains unpredictable, with mixed views among market participants. However, some traders believe the alignment of these indicators increases the chance of a rebound in Bitcoin's price. For instance, the four-hour and six-hour charts show a bullish divergence with oversold RSI.
Currently, Bitcoin is trading at $115,114.89, below its recent record high of $124,000. If the $112,000 level holds, it could open the way for another rise in Bitcoin's price. Interestingly, $112,000 has been acting as a strong support level for Bitcoin. However, if this level fails, the market could see more pressure on Bitcoin's price.
Meanwhile, in the Philippines, a significant development is unfolding. A new bill, the Strategic Bitcoin Reserve Act, has been introduced to buy 2,000 BTC annually for five years and hold it for twenty years. The goal of the bill is to strengthen the country's financial position and add long-term stability. If approved, the Philippines plans to hold the Bitcoin for twenty years.
The Strategic Bitcoin Reserve Act is a major move towards Bitcoin adoption by a country. The bill's sponsors believe it would help the Philippines participate in the growing global cryptocurrency market.
